Abstract

This study examines the efficiency of electric power in BLDC motors as electric motorcycle drivers with various load and speed experiments. Electric motorcycles are one of the vehicles that are in great demand by the public. BLDC motors are the main drivers of electric motorcycles where motor capacity planning includes motor power and torque which greatly affect the acceleration and speed of the motorcycle. Motor capacity planning is obtained by calculating the total weight, the location of the motor's center of gravity, the desired acceleration, tire rolling resistance to asphalt, air resistance and road slope angle. From the calculations and analyses that have been carried out, the required motor power is 2.5 kW. Testing the motor's ability to carry loads is carried out by providing variations in passenger and goods loads of 58 kg, 98 kg and 135 kg, and driven with a target speed of 10 km / h, 20 km / h and 30 km / h.
